Book Synopsis
With extensive ethnographic and archival work, this book analyzes the works of Carlos Vives and La Provincia, the most influential artists of Colombia’s music scene in the last twenty-five years, to uncover the basis of the Land of Oblivion, a musical and literary metaphor for Colombia’s national identity.
